What do you guys do to get kiting access at sod farms? There's one not terribly far from me, but I haven't the slightest idea on how to approach the
owner. For that matter, I don't know how to find out who the owner is.
ClintSCREWYFITS - 19-8-2008 at 03:44 AM
Hey Clint,
You just have to drive out there and ask for the manager and feed him a line like; you have a request (kind of a strange one) and would like to know
if you could fly kites on their farm... Or, You fly power kites and would like to know if you could possibly fly them on their fields, there is not
many places that have the room to fly them... Or start off like I' have a question and I'm unsure what to expect but I'd like to fly kites on your
fields if it would be OK... mostly expect a no and that way it will always be at least what you expected... a yes will be good surprise... you could
also use other farms that other kiters use and tell them that this field allows us to fly kites on their farm and that their farm is much closer to
you and would be grateful if you could use theirs...
Maybe some others here could come up with good opening lines too...
Maybe take a friend with to ask... If they allow you to, try to start slow with small kites nothing too daring...
Try and get their/managers info so you can email/call and tell them you'd like to come out again and if there is any field they would like you to use
or steer clear of...
Maybe take them a big bag of Jerky, case of Gatorade or a fruit basket once in a while because you guys are the ones benefiting and you have to show
appreciation... even a buy them lunch once a year... once you get to fly on their field you will want to give them the world because its like
Disneyland for kiters...
After a couple times going ask if you could use a buggy and show it to them so they understand what it is... They most likely won't care much if
they've been letting you out there, their tractors don't do damage so the lil a$$ bug isn't gonna do #@%$#!... "ONE BIG THING, "DO
NOT" LEAVE ANY STAKES OUT THERE FOR THEIR LAWN MOWERS TO PICK UP" or any thing else for that matter...
I wouldn't offer it, but if it comes up, tell them you be willing to sign a release of liability form if that would make them feel better...
Good luck...
